About the role
- Reporting to the Retail Distribution Lead, the Business Development Associate will support strategies aimed at increasing premium production in their region.
- Manage smaller, established partners and newly onboarded partners, ensuring integration and growth.
- Develop strategies for partner cohorts and provide insights on portfolio makeup during quarterly reviews.
- Collaborate with underwriting, marketing, and development teams to develop, manage, and drive distribution and partner premium generation.
- Oversee a portfolio of emerging and lower-volume partners, fostering relationships, identifying growth potential, and ensuring consistent performance.
- Provide pipeline support by researching target markets, potential partners, and competitive intelligence.
- Represent Cover Whale in meetings with distribution partners and support event and field presence efforts.
- Establish, track, and report on KPIs while routinely meeting or exceeding goals.
- Assist in improving business development, partner management, and onboarding processes.
- Maintain CRM accuracy by updating partner interactions, notes, and performance data promptly.
- Monitor partner performance trends and flag opportunities or risks to the Business Development Manager or Leader.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, or similar
- 3+ years in fast-paced project management or consulting roles, preferably in the insurance industry.
- Experience in onboarding and guiding new customers to realize and repeat value.
- Strong phone and video skills, maintaining professionalism under pressure.
- Ability to manage a portfolio with strong prioritization and multitasking.
- Exceptional interpersonal skills, able to discuss technical and business topics seamlessly.
- Proven in communicating, presenting, and influencing at all organizational levels, including executives.
